%0 Journal Article %T The Evolution of Genetic Variability at the LRRK2 Locus. %A Guenther DT %A Follett J %A Amouri R %A Sassi SB %A Hentati F %A Farrer MJ %J Genes (Basel) %V 15 %N 7 %D 2024 Jul 3 %M 39062657 %F 4.141 %R 10.3390/genes15070878 %X Leucine-rich repeat kinase 2 (LRRK2) c.6055G>A (p.G2019S) is a frequent cause of Parkinson's disease (PD), accounting for >30% of Tunisian Arab-Berber patients. LRRK2 is widely expressed in the immune system and its kinase activity confers a survival advantage against infection in animal models. Here, we assess haplotype variability in cis and in trans of the LRRK2 c.6055G>A mutation, define the age of the pathogenic allele, explore its relationship to the age of disease onset (AOO), and provide evidence for its positive selection.
